Around 8pm, Sunday 15 August 2021, police on patrol in Beckenham sighted a stolen Hyundai Tucson and attempted to stop it.

It will be alleged the driver failed to stop and accelerated away on William Street. A police helicopter was deployed to the scene and took over the monitoring of the stolen vehicle from the air.

It will be alleged the driver of the stolen vehicle drove it in a manner which was reckless and dangerous to the public.

The stolen vehicle was driven onto West Road, Bassendean and into the car park area at Sandy Beach Reserve where the road terminates. At the end of the car park the driver attempted to turn to drive out of the car park however collided with a white Hyundai Elantra, causing damage to both vehicles.

Police officers moved in and arrested the driver.

A 33-year-old man from High Wycombe has been charged with:
- Fail to Stop
- Reckless Driving (to evade police)
- Steal Motor Vehicle
- No Authority to Drive
- Steal Motor Vehicle and Drive Recklessly
- Assault with Intent to Prevent Arrest
- Give False Details to Police
- Criminal Damage

He was refused bail and appeared in the Midland Magistrates Court on Monday 16 August 2021.
